The inclusion of hemp in the 2018 farm bill has many people — both inside and outside the agriculture sector – racing to figure out the potential market for this relatively new (well, new to the U.S., at least) agricultural product. Hemp’s proponents are growing more optimistic and vocal each year about hemp as a potential game changer for U.S. agriculture. Whether you think hemp is the next big thing, see it with more moderate potential as a new crop for farmers, or if you believe it will be a big dud, everyone can agree that farmers, policymakers and the general public are showing an increasing interest in the product.
